About Calvert Koerber
Baltimore, Maryland 1949, I was born at a very young age. Began drawing as soon as I was old enough to pick up a pencil. Attended Baltimore City schools from 1955 to 1968. During this period of time I had spent four years in Baltimore Polytechnic High School, two years of which was in the eleventh grade, mainly because I liked it so much. While in high school I was first introduced to Mechanical Drawing. In 1968 I finally graduated and enlisted in the United States Army, staying there until 1970 after an exciting but short military career.
